SRI LANKAN TROOPS OF 16TH SLFPC CONTINGENT ATTENDS IN THE RESERVE INTEGRATION TRAINING EXERCISE (RITEX) AS ROLE PLAYERS IN NAQOURA CAMP, UNIFIL

Continuing Sri Lanka’s steadfast commitment to global peace and stability, the 16th Contingent of the Sri Lanka Force Protection Company (SLFPC) after assuming peacekeeping duties officially under the United Nations Interim Force in Lebanon (UNIFIL) attended as role players for Patrolling, CASEVAC and Denial of Freedom of Movement activities along with the Indonesian Force Protection Unit and Malaysian Battalion in scenarios created as IED explosion followed by ambush and escorting the CASEVAC. Sri Lankan peacekeepers comprising two Officers and 16 Other Ranks attended the exercise along with two Armoured Personnel Carriers (APC), and exercise was conducted on 16 and 17 July 2025
